Immigrants from Venezuela vs Immigrants from Western Africa Wage/Income Gap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 287,795,884 people shows a weak positive corre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Venezuela and wage/income gap percentage in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.265 and weighted average of 26.2%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 357,735,859 people shows a weak negative corre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Western Africa and wage/income gap percentage in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.289 and weighted average of 22.0%, a difference of 19.0%.

Wage/Income Gap Correlation Summary
Measurement | Immigrants from Venezuela | Immigrants from Western Africa |
Minimum | 1.7% | 3.6% |
Maximum | 65.5% | 36.5% |
Range | 63.8% | 33.0% |
Mean | 27.2% | 19.4% |
Median | 25.5% | 20.3% |
Interquartile 25% (IQ1) | 22.1% | 16.0% |
Interquartile 75% (IQ3) | 30.8% | 22.6% |
Interquartile Range (IQR) | 8.6% | 6.6% |
Standard Deviation (Sample) | 10.4% | 5.7% |
Standard Deviation (Population) | 10.3% | 5.7% |
